Canadian leisure community CBC has a Shark Tank–like present known as Dragons’ Den, the place buyers hear pitches from companies on the lookout for funding. This season, Chinese language-Canadian actor Simu Liu—who starred in Marvel’s Shang-Chi and the Legend of the Ten Rings—was a visitor “dragon” and potential investor on an episode. 

The house owners of a Quebec-based bubble tea firm known as Bobba got here to Dragons’ Den on this episode, in search of a $1 million funding to develop their model. As they pitched, the strain between Simu Liu and Bobba founders Sebastien Fiset and Jess Frenette grew to become obvious. 

Boba tea is a Taiwanese tea drink that has lately risen in recognition in the USA. Nonetheless, Frenette described boba, or bubble tea, as a “stylish, sugary drink” and advised that customers are “by no means fairly positive about its contents.”

Liu took situation with the founders’ plan to “disrupt” the market with their product and raised questions regarding the firm’s supposed cultural appropriation. The ensuing clips from this Dragons’ Den episode have gone viral, with hundreds of thousands of views on social media. The actor has since issued a public assertion in regards to the controversy.

In the end, Liu determined to not spend money on Bobba, saying that he “could be uplifting a enterprise that’s profiting off of one thing that feels so pricey to my cultural heritage. I wish to be part of bringing boba to the plenty—however not like this.”

This controversy highlights how necessary it’s for companies to be culturally delicate and the consequences they will have after they aren’t.

Listed below are 4 methods you’ll be able to decide whether or not what you are promoting is culturally delicate and how one can make it inclusive, particularly with the vacation season approaching.

1. Suppose issues by way of to keep away from unintentional cultural appropriation

Liu’s boba tea controversy isn’t the one culturally insensitive incident to have gone viral. In 2022, Tub and Physique Works tried to honor Juneteenth with its product packaging for Black Historical past Month in a method that was not well-thought-out. In line with the Miami Herald, shoppers criticized its merchandise as “’trash,’ ’cheesy’ and [an] instance of ’tradition appropriation.’”

Katya Varbanova, a model advertising and marketing skilled, argues that understanding cultural sensitivity needs to be the naked minimal for companies.

“I believe the most important lesson that we will take away from that is… understanding tradition, particularly Zillennial tradition… and this new era of what expectations they’ve from manufacturers,” she says. “[Businesses] want to know that it’s the naked minimal to know what’s culturally related, what’s culturally delicate, and the subject of cultural appropriation has been a subject that Gen Z and Millennials have been extremely obsessed with.”

Varbanova additionally notes that manufacturers and entrepreneurs have to get suggestions early on—not simply from inside their firm but additionally from their native space and world prospects.

2. Analysis related cultural historical past and educate your self when creating

How can firms and types respectfully honor numerous traditions and celebrations? The easiest way to make sure that what you are promoting is culturally delicate is to begin your product creation course of, advertising and marketing, buyer and worker communication, and branding from a spot of deep analysis. 

You possibly can’t be culturally delicate if you happen to don’t perceive culture-specific historical past. Even when creating content material, it is best to know the context and significance of any cultural phenomenon earlier than you create and talk. 

In consequence, it is best to kind a analysis course of that includes analyzing historical past and necessary culture-specific info. Educate your self on issues you might not find out about your content material’s matter if it includes different cultures. You should utilize AI instruments reminiscent of ChatGPT or Google Gemini to compile the knowledge to make it simpler to know. 

“I believe one of the crucial necessary issues for enterprise house owners to recollect is that, as folks, all of us make judgments in a short time about whether or not we wish to do enterprise with another person,” says Afya Evans, a picture advisor who does government teaching for high-level, media-facing professionals. “We’ve all heard that folks do enterprise with folks that they know, like and belief. However the science tells us that… most of us make these choices inside seconds.

“And so, what’s necessary is to make these very first impressions to stay as a result of it’s very exhausting to alter,” she provides. ”And so these very first encounters are crucial.”

3. Talk with cultural sensitivity and rejoice cultural range

A enterprise communicates with staff, prospects, buyers and key stakeholders in a number of methods, which all have an effect on the model’s development. As we noticed with Bobba on Dragons’ Den, a scarcity of culturally delicate communication can sink a enterprise—however speaking with cultural sensitivity creates a enterprise that staff wish to work for and shoppers wish to do enterprise with.

Staff and shoppers additionally wish to see themselves represented in a model. 2019 knowledge from Google confirmed that 70% of surveyed Black and LGBTQ+ shoppers have been extra prone to work together with manufacturers whose promoting represented their identities. Two out of three Individuals additionally mentioned their social values formed their buying selections, in accordance with a 2021 McKinsey research.

“Cultural insensitivity can damage the model… however [it] can also damage the corporate with attracting and retaining expertise,” says Vivian Acquah, a licensed range, fairness and inclusion advisor and coach. “[Its] consumer base can [also] really feel like they aren’t gonna purchase any extra merchandise from you…. The dearth of sensitivity can hurt the companies… at an even bigger tempo as effectively.”

With the vacations quick approaching, that is the time to make sure that your communication is culturally delicate and celebrates cultural range, as there are celebrations and traditions past typical American holidays. Think about religions, folks teams and cultural holidays when creating content material for what you are promoting.

Good communication includes being clear but additionally participating in energetic listening. As you analysis and create, keep away from stereotypes and take a look at to not make assumptions about anybody or something if you happen to don’t know their cultural background. You also needs to be open to suggestions from staff, shoppers and others that brings to gentle any cultural insensitivity.

4. Construct an inclusive enterprise

Probably the greatest methods to make sure that you’re constructing a culturally delicate enterprise is to maintain inclusivity in thoughts. Within the beforehand talked about episode of Dragons’ Den, Liu requested the Bobba tea firm, “What respect is being paid to this very Asian drink that has blown up around the globe? Is it in your teas? Is it in your product improvement? Who’s in your employees? Who’s in your cap desk that’s offering that for you?”

Inclusive companies are constructed utilizing various communication, groups, branding and advertising and marketing, in addition to the flexibility to regulate when a problem arises. Being a culturally delicate enterprise is a development technique that improves worker retention and engages shoppers as a result of they really feel represented.

Is what you are promoting culturally delicate?

Asian entrepreneurs Olivia Chen and Pauline Ang are pals and enterprise companions who personal a boba tea model known as Twrl. They tried 3 times to get on ABC’s Shark Tank however couldn’t. After they posted a video on TikTok in assist of Liu’s callout of cultural appropriation, Liu invited them to ship his crew a pitch deck so he might spend money on Twrl. 

The Simu Liu boba tea controversy teaches us that constructing a culturally delicate enterprise issues, and it’ll have an effect on a enterprise’s development if you don’t. You possibly can create a culturally delicate and consultant enterprise by researching different cultures, creating with inclusivity and considering issues by way of.
